Shechem's In the Kitchen With Dinah
(best when sung)
Shechem’s in the kitchen with Dinah
He’s in trouble, don’t you know? oh oh oh
Shechem’s in the kitchen with Dinah
Simeon’s about to blow
See, Dinah was Jacob’s daughter
Shechem wanted for a wife
He took her much too early
And started all the strife
Shechem’s father went to Jacob
He asked for Dinah‘s hand
They’d intermarry daughters
Make peace throughout the land
Jacob’s sons got wind of this
And they got really pissed
They came up with a little plan
A sort of grown up bris
The plot was circumcision
There’d be no deal without
Shechem’s dad convinced his men
He must have had some clout
“See, we’ll marry their daughters
They’ll do just the same.”
So Hamor’s men all lined up
They put skin in the game
A few days soon thereafter
When everyone was sore
Simeon and Judah walked right in
And killed them with the sword
Then Jacob grew quite angry
“You’ve brought our family shame
The Canaanites will come after us
And blot out our good name.”
His sons weren’t having any
Saw no need for redress
The honor of their sister
Was worth this awful mess
Shech went in the kitchen with Dinah
It was a costly trip, oh oh oh
Thought that he could dine for free
Her brothers forced the tip
(from Genesis 34)
